Ignore:
Timestamp:
Oct 9, 2009, 6:07:50 PM (10 years ago)
Author:
gz
Message:

fixes for slots with non-standard allocation (r12760,r12761,r12762,r12765, r12905)

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/working-0711/ccl/level-0/X86/x86-clos.lisp

    r11069 r12950  
    7575  (movq (@ 'class (% fn)) (% arg_x))
    7676  (set-nargs 3)
    77   (jmp (@ '%maybe-std-std-value-using-class (% fn)))
     77  (jmp (@ '%maybe-std-slot-value-using-class (% fn)))
    7878  @missing                              ; (%slot-id-ref-missing instance id)
    7979  (set-nargs 2)
     
    9696  (movq (@ 'class (% fn)) (% arg_x))
    9797  (set-nargs 3)
    98   (jmp (@ '%maybe-std-std-value-using-class (% fn)))
     98  (jmp (@ '%maybe-std-slot-value-using-class (% fn)))
    9999  @missing                              ; (%slot-id-ref-missing instance id)
    100100  (set-nargs 2)
Note: See TracChangeset for help on using the changeset viewer.